Comprehending Vinyl Windows
Before diving into the repair procedure, it's crucial to comprehend what vinyl windows are and what makes them advantageous. Vinyl windows are built from polyvinyl chloride (PVC), which supplies flexibility and resistance to moisture and UV rays.
Advantages of Vinyl Windows
| Advantage | Description |
|---|---|
| Energy Efficiency | Vinyl windows have excellent insulation qualities, minimizing heating & cooling expenses. |
| Low Maintenance | They do not require painting, staining, or sealing. Just an easy wash will do! |
| Toughness | Vinyl frames withstand wear and tear from weather direct exposure. |
| Cost-Effective | Normally more affordable compared to wood or aluminum windows. |
Typical Problems with Vinyl Windows
Despite their toughness, vinyl windows can develop a number of common problems that house owners might experience:
| Problem | Description |
|---|---|
| Condensation | Excess wetness can result in condensation in between the panes, showing seal failure. |
| Cracked Frame | Impact or extreme temperatures can cause cracks in the vinyl frame. |
| Tough Operation | Dirt, particles, or damaged hardware can make windows hard to open or close. |
| Contorting | Extended direct exposure to heat can warp the window frame, triggering it to misalign. |
| Foggy Glass | This typically suggests broken seals, enabling moisture to get in between glass panes. |
Steps for Vinyl Window Repair
Repairing vinyl windows can frequently be finished with very little tools and effort. Here's a detailed guide to resolve a few of the most typical problems.
1. Repairing Condensation Issues
| Step | Action |
|---|---|
| 1 | Examine for broken seals or foggy glass. |

2. Fixing Cracks in the Frame
| Step | Action |
|---|---|
| 1 | Tidy the location around the crack completely. |
| 2 | Utilize a vinyl repair set to complete the crack. |
| 3 | Use a vinyl adhesive for extra strength, if needed. |
| 4 | Smooth down the fixed location to ensure it's even with the frame. |
3. Improving Window Operation
| Action | Action |
|---|---|

| 2 | Inspect the window hardware (locks, hinges) for damage. |
| 3 | Apply lube to the moving parts for easier operation. |
| 4 | Change any damaged hardware if essential. |
4. Dealing with Warping
| Action | Action |
|---|---|
| 1 | Inspect if the warping is affecting the window's opening or closing mechanisms. |
| 2 | If minor, attempt correcting the frame by heating it slightly with a hairdryer. |
| 3 | For significant warping, replacement of the frame might be essential. |
Regular Maintenance Tips
Preventative maintenance can substantially extend the life of vinyl windows. Here are some suggestions to keep your windows in top condition:
- Clean Regularly: Use a soft fabric and moderate cleaning agent to tidy glass and frames.
- Inspect Seals: Check weatherstripping and seals each year for damage.
- Lube Moving Parts: Regularly use lube to locks and hinges to preserve smooth operation.
- Trim Vegetation: Ensure shrubs or trees do not obstruct the windows and trap wetness.
